Primary Function of Position 

This position will be responsible for the management of the day-to-day production requirements for operations are maintained to support the RMA schedule. This role is responsible to maintain and report RMA metrics related to quality, on-time performance and RMA supervision

Essential Job Duties 

  • Hire, train, develop, and motivate RMA personnel to follow procedures, meet high quality standards, repair schedules, and productivity requirements

  • Update and revise Manufacturing Process Instructions to ensure that MPIs are accurate and complete

  • Address line support issues as they arise

  • Work closely with Product Support, Sustaining Engineering and other Departments to help with resolution of repair issues

  • Document and report any variances, problems, issues, or concerns

  • Provide RMA personnel with expectations and performance feedback weekly

  • Drive improvements in safety, quality, production, and cost

  • Deliver written quarterly performance reviews for RMA personnel

  • In cooperation with Service Depot Director plan, supervise, drive improvement, and report RMA performance including output, yields, root cause failures, efficiencies, and trends

  • Responsible for repair cost analyses, including trends, prognoses and recommendations.

  • Provides repair cost reduction suggestions/projects and manages their implementation

  • Ensuring correct quantities and cycle times of repaired parts

  • Reviews and reports monthly operational expenses related to repair cost

  • Manage the performance of the service operation cells with regard to repair cost, cycle time, and customer service

  • Manage NPI and the addition of new FRU’s to support them

  • Maintain and report on goals for RMA returns

  • Maintain department operating procedures (DOP’s) and work instructions.

  • Write and deliver quarterly performance reviews to all employees in RMA department

  • Track and present results to senior level management within the Service Ops.

  • Understand, train personnel, and enforce strict adherence to the applicable DOPs and SOPs of the Quality System

  • Maintain up to date and accessible training records for MPIs and Quality System documents

  • Assist in setting and attaining quarterly and annual goals

  • Learn and enforce company safety policies and practices

U.S. Export Controls Disclaimer:  In accordance with the U.S. Export Administration Regulations (15 CFR §743.13(b)), some roles at Intuitive Surgical may be subject to U.S. export controls for prospective employees
who are nationals from countries currently on embargo or sanctions status.

Certain information you provide as part of the application will be used for purposes of determining whether Intuitive Surgical will need to (i) obtain an export license from the U.S. Government on your behalf (note: the government’s licensing process can take 3 to 6+ months) or (ii) implement a Technology Control Plan (“TCP”) (note: typically adds 2 weeks to the hiring process).  

For any Intuitive role subject to export controls, final offers are contingent upon obtaining an approved export license and/or an executed TCP prior to the prospective employee’s
start date, which may or may not be flexible, and within a timeframe that does not unreasonably impede the hiring need. If applicable, candidates will be notified and instructed on any requirements for these purposes.
